Hon Hai Sales Growth Accelerates Beyond Estimates in May Bloomberg.com
The accelerating sales growth of a major electronics manufacturer like Hon Hai suggests robust demand, potentially driven by new product cycles or increased component orders related to AI hardware.
A strategic reader should care as Hon Hai's performance is a bellwether for the broader electronics manufacturing sector and provides insights into underlying demand for technology components.
Stronger-than-expected sales from a key supplier indicate that the demand side of the compute supply chain may be more resilient or accelerating faster than previously modeled.
